The Santa Clarita Municipal Code is amended to add Title 14, relating to parks and other public places, to read as follows: Title 14 PARRS AND OTHER PUBLIC PLACES Chapter 14.02 DEFINITIONS 14.02.010 As used in this chapter, the words hereinafter defined are used as so defined unless it is apparent from the context that a different meaning is intended. A. Alcoholic beverages. "Alcoholic beverages" means alcohol, spirits, liquor, wine, beer and every liquid containing one-half of one percent (0.0050 or more of alcohol by volume, and which is fit for beverage purposes either alone or when diluted, mixed or combined with other substances. B. Director. "Director" means the director of parks and recreation, or other person authorized by the director pursuant to law. C. Motor vehicles. "Motor vehicles" means any multi -wheeled, treaded or sled -type vehicle that is propelled by a motor engine, including any vehicle commonly known as a "motorized recreation vehicle." D. Narcotics and dangerous drugs. "Narcotics and dangerous drugs" means those narcotics and drugs listed or defined in the Health and Safety Code of the state of California as now or hereafter amended. E. Park. "Park" means every park, roadside rest, golf course, riding and hiking trail, open space easement to which the public has an unrestricted right of access and use for park or recreation purposes, and every other recreation facility owned, managed or controlled by the City and under the jurisdiction of the director. Chapter 14.04 GENERAL PROVISIONS 14.04.010 Title for citation. The ordinance codified in this chapter shall be known as and may be cited as the "park ordinance." -1- TBM/WP/COD81025 0 14.04.020 Delegation of powers. Whenever a power is granted to or a duty is posed upon the director or other public officer, the power may be exercised or the duty performed by a deputy of the public officer or other person so authorized, pursuant to law, by the director, except as otherwise provided by this chapter. 14.04.030 Facilities under director's control designated - Enforcement authority. The director is vested with authority over and control of all facilities owned, leased, controlled, constructed or maintained by a lessee or private fee owner in any park, for the purpose of causing corrected any condition which violates or which would tend to cause or contribute to any violation of the purpose and provisions of this chapter. 14.04.040 Signs - Placement and maintenance authority - Obedience required. The director may place and maintain, or cause to be placed and maintained, either on land or water, such signs, notices, signals, buoys or control devices necessary to carry out the provisions of this chapter, or to insure public and orderly and efficient use of any park or park waters. A person shall not fail to obey any sign, notice, signal, control device or buoy placed or erected pursuant to this section. 14.04.050 Compliance with chapter provisions - Ejection of violators authorized when. Permission to be within the limits of any park or park waters, as defined by this chapter, or to use any facilities, is conditioned on the person present in park or park waters complying with all applicable provisions of this chapter other applicable laws, ordinances, rules and regulations. A violation of any provision of this chapter or of any order, rule or regulation authorized by this chapter, or of any other applicable law, ordinance, rule or regulation shall result in the person so violating being a trespasser, and a peace officer or the director may eject any such person from a park. 14.04.060 Enforcement authority. Except as specifically provided in this chapter, the director shall enforce the provisions of this chapter. 14.04.070 Liability limitations. A person exercising any of the privileges authorized by this chapter does so at his or her own risk without liability on the City or its officers, employees and agents, for death or injury to persons or damage to property resulting therefrom. TBM/WP/COD81025 -2- Chapter 14.06 PARK RULES AND REGULATIONS 14.06.010 Applicability of regulations. The following rules and regulations apply to all parks in the City except as otherwise expressly stated. 14.06.020 Hours of operation. A person shall not enter, be or remain in any park or in any building in any park between the hours of 10:00 p.m. and sunrise on the following day except as authorized by a written permit issued by the director. The director may, from time to time, change the hours of use as stated above for any event or individual park. All persons shall comply with such changed hours. A person shall not park or cause to be parked any motor vehicle in any park or parking facility for such park between the hours of 10:00 p.m. and sunrise or the following day. 14.06.030 Park property and vegetation - Damaging or removing prohibited - Exception. It shall be punishable as a misdemeanor for any person, other than a duly authorized park employee in the performance of his duties, to: A. Dig, remove, destroy, injure, mutilate or cut any tree, plant, shrub, grass, fruit or flower, or any portion thereof, growing in the park; B. Remove any wood, turf, grass, soil, rock, sand or gravel from any park; C. Cut, break, injure, deface or disturb any rock, building, cage, pen, monument, sign, fence, bench, structure, apparatus, equipment or property in a park or any portion thereof, or mark or place thereon, or on any portion thereof, any mark, writing or printing; or attach thereto any sign, card, display or other similar device. 14.06.060 Motor vesicle restrictions - Parking. A person shall not bring to or operate in any park any motor vehicle except at such times and at such places as permitted by the director in written regulations or permits issued from time to time, and any such operation of a motor vehicle shall be in accordance with the conditions contained in such regulation or permit. A person shall not park any motor vehicle in any park except in areas designated by the director for parking. -3- TBM/WP/COD81025 14.06.070 House trailers and other camping vehicles. A person shall not bring a house trailer or other recreation travel trailer type vehicle which can be used for overnight sleeping purposes into any park not having a designated overnight camping area except when authorized by the director for firefighting or other public emergencies. 14.06.080 Overnight camping restrictions - Permit issuance conditions. A. A person shall not camp or sleep overnight in any park except where a family -type camping area is so designated, and then only in accordance with the rules and regulations governing the use of such area. The director may issue a permit to any youth group of a character -building nature and to any special-interest group permitting its members as a group to camp overnight at a designated location in a park if the director finds: 1. That, in the case of a youth group, the group was organized in good faith and not for the purpose of obtaining a permit under this section, and the members of such group will be supervised during such camping by an adequate number of responsible adults and such overnight camping will not interfere with or in any way be detrimental to the park or interfere with the uses thereof, and 2. That the group has agreed to the conditions contained in the permit. B. Upon the granting of such permit, the members of such group, including the adult supervisors, may camp at the time, location and under the conditions specified in the permit. 14.06.090 Animals - Prohibited when. A person shall not bring into a park any cattle, horse, mule, goat, sheep, swine, dog, cat or other animal of any kind except as hereafter specifically provided or as otherwise permitted by the director. A person may ride a horse, mule, donkey or other similar animal only on designated trails or in designated equestrian areas subject to all rules and regulations governing their use, in other park areas upon written permission of the director, subject to the regulations of such use permit. Violation of this section is punishable as a misdemeanor. 14.06.130 Disturbances prohibited. It shall be a misdemeanor for any person to disturb the peace and quiet of any park by: A. Any unduly loud or unusual noise; or B. Tooting, blowing or sounding any siren, horn, signal or noise -making device; or C. Any obscene, violent or riotous conduct; or therein. D. The use of any vulgar, profane or indecent language 14.06.140 Alcoholic beverages and narcotics or dangerous drugs. A person shall not enter, be or remain in any park while in possession of, transporting, arising, selling, giving away or consuming any alcoholic beverage except at a concession facility duly authorized by the City Council and properly licensed or in connection with a special event duly authorized by the director of the department of parks and recreation for which the sponsoring organization is properly licensed by the State Department of Alcoholic Beverage Control. A person shall not enter, be or remain in any park while in possession or transporting, arising, selling, giving away or consuming any narcotics and dangerous drugs. Violation of this section is punishable as a misdemeanor. 14.06.150 Public intoxication prohibited. A person shall not enter, remain or be in any park while he or she is under the influence of any alcoholic beverage or narcotic and dangerous drug. 14.06.160 Soliciting for or selling merchandise - Restrictions. A person shall not solicit in any manner or for any purpose, or sell or offer for sale any goods, wares or merchandise, or distribute or pass out any handbill, advertising matter or literature therein except when found by the city council or director to be consistent with the policies of the .. department of parks and recreation or to promote the programs of said department, under conditions prescribed by the city council or director. -5- TBM/WP/COD81025 14.06.180 Nudity and disrobing prohibited - Excpetions. A. No person shall appear, bathe, sunbathe, walk, change clothes, disrobe or be in any park in such a manner that the genitals, vulva, pubis, pubic symphysis, pubic hair, but- tocks, natal cleft, perineum, anus, anal region or pubic hair region of any person, or any portion of the breast at or below the upper edge of the areola thereof of any female person, is exposed to public view, except in those portions of a comfort station, if any, expressly set aside for such purpose. Violation of this section is punishable as a misdemeanor. B. This section shall not apply to persons under the age of 10 years, provided such children are sufficiently clothed to conform to accepted community standards. C. This section shall not apply to persons engaged in a live theatrical performance in a theater, concert hall or similar establishment which is primarily devoted to theatrical performances. 14.06.190 Washing dishes or polluting water. A ,., person shall not place in any park waters any edible matter, dish or utensil, or wash or cleanse in any park waters any such edible matter, dish or utensil, or commit any nuisance in or near such waters, or pollute any parks' waters, or bathe, swim or wade in park waters except at places and times designated by the director. 14.06.195 Rubbish disposal. A person shall not throw, place or dispose of any garbage, refuse, waste paper, bottles or cans in any place in a park other than into a garbage can or other receptacle maintained therein for that purpose. No garbage, refuse, waste paper, bottles or cans shall be brought into a park for the purpose of disposing any such receptacle. 14.06.200 Concessions and other facilities - Sanitation requirements. The lessee, agent, manager or person in charge of a facility or water area under lease or concession from the city, or owned in fee in any city park, shall at all times maintain the premises in a clean, sanitary condition, free from malodorous materials and accumulations of garbage, refuse, debris and other waste materials. Should the director find that any facility or water area under concession or lease is not so maintained, the director shall in writing notify said concession- aire, lessee, agent, manager or other person in charge of said facility or area to immediately commence and diligently prosecute to completion the necessary correction of the sanitary condition to the satisfaction of the director. Failure to do so with -6- TBM/WP/COD81025 reasonable dispatch shall be cause for the director to cause the condition to be corrected as necessary, and the costs of such correction to be charged to the lessee, concessionaire, agent, manager or person in charge. Violation of this section is punishable as a misdemeanor. 14.06.220 Fires. A person shall not light or maintain any fire in any park other than in a stove, fire circle or area designated for such purpose, except upon written authorization from the director. Violation of this section is punishable as a misdemeanor. 14.06.230 Harmful objects. A person shall not place, throw, leave, keep or maintain any object in such a manner or in such a place that any person or animal ay be injured or any structure or vehicle may be damaged thereby. 14.06.240 Firearms and other weapons. A person shall not bring into, discharge, or shoot any firearms, air gun, slingshot, or bow and arrow in any park, except in areas designated for such use. Violation of this provision is punishable as a misdemeanor. 14.06.250 Model airplanes and boats. A person shall not operate model air planes, boats or crafts except in areas designated for such use, and subject to all rules and regulations contained in such written permission. 14.06.260 Sleds, skis and other winter sports equipment. A person shall not hitch or pull by any vehicle upon, along or across any road or driveway any toboggan, sled, skis or any other type of winter sports equipment. 14.06.270 Golf prohibited. No person shall play the game of golf in any of its form or refinements, including the activity known as putting, by the use of a golf club or clubs, or similar instrument, to strike a golf ball in any park. 14.06.280 Roller skating and skateboards prohibited. No person shall operate any roller skates, as that term is defined at section 12.08.160 of this code, or skateboard, as that term is defined at section 12.08.155 of this code, in any park, except upon the approval of the director. -7- TSM/WP/COD81025 Chapter 14.08 RIDING AND HIRING TRAILS 14.08.010 Operation of motor vehicles prohibited where. A person shall not operate any motor vehicle on or over any firebreak or any fire protection roads which are posted against public use and provided with locked gates, or operate any motor vehicle on or over any riding or hiking trail, including a riding and hiking trial established under Article 6 of Chapter i of Division 5 of the Public Resources Code of the state of California, except as otherwise provided in Section 14.06.060 of this chapter.
